Motorcycle & Bicycle Laws in Louisiana. Louisiana Helmet Laws. Motorcycles. All Louisiana motorcycle riders and passengers must wear a safety helmet designed with lining, padding and visor, and secured properly with a chinstrap while the vehicle is in motion. This law also applies to motor-driven cycles and motorized bicycles.Louisiana Motorcycle Helmet Law. Anyone who rides a motorcycle in the state of Louisiana, including passengers, is required to wear a helmet specifically manufactured for motorcycle riders. The helmet must be secured by a chin strap when the vehicle is in motion, according to Louisiana Revised Statutes 32:190. Riders over 21 can choose whether or not they want to wear a helmet, but if they opt not to, they must be able to prove a minimum medical coverage of ...Dec 1, 2023 · Louisiana is what's known as a "No Pay, No Play" state when it comes to auto insurance. This means that if you're uninsured and are in an accident, you cannot collect the first $25,000 in property damages and the first $15,000 in personal injuries, regardless of who caused the accident.
